React context typescript example github. Automate any workflow Codespaces.
React context typescript example github TypeScript, React Router, React Testing Library and custom ESlint config However, the general consensus today is that React. So, I thought In the React SPA folder the files starting with . store React hooks for SignalR. GitHub is where people build software. More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. An alternative is to use the React Context API. All 1 JavaScript 15 CSS 1 Objective-C 1 TypeScript 1. To associate your . Reload to refresh your session. js import {Context} from 'context' const App = () => { const More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. spec. Viact is a starter template for React TypeScript that uses Vitejs, which The below article will give you an overview with an example of how to use the useContext() hook and also update the globally set context value in child components. js patterns. Contribute to pguilbert/react-use-signalr development by creating an account on GitHub. React context+hook+reducer sample app. displayName = "Context"; export const Provider = (props: React. Some snippets support an "inline" version as where the const More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. Redux Thunk, Redux Saga, Creating Context in React TypeScript (Example). Each snippet is defined under a snippet name and GitHub is where people build software. . env can be overridden by the environment-specific file (. If a component asks for Contribute to hdminh247/reactjs. I created an example app (linked here) that uses React Context to display pages with lists of questions. - rjz/react-with-typescript More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. You signed in with another tab or window. This article will guide you through the process of setting up and implementing the Created with CodeSandbox. 🌳 - bjerkio/oidc-react GitHub community articles Repositories. When a context value is changed, all components that useContext will re React Context Modals allows you to very easily add flexible modals to any project, any component can be turned into a modal. The GitHub is where people build software. PropsWithChildren) This article demonstrates how to use React Context and the Context API to manage tasks in a TypeScript to-do app. FunctionComponent (or the shorthand React. - Lemoncode/react-typescript-samples React TypeScript realworld example app. This example app uses createReducer to manage 3 actions. 18 HOC. However, the user can still open the GitHub Copilot. Find and fix vulnerabilities Actions. Where should I look if I want to dive deeper? One of the best places to dive deeper Demo and reference implementation for React. json has many options, all of which you can learn about here in the TypeScript Handbook. Context is designed to share data that can be In React, dealing with props might be too verbose and not efficient. marsinearth / state react-context-boilerplate. You switched accounts on another tab Minimalistic provider built around native Contextmenu Event. - Lemoncode/react-by-sample GitHub community articles Repositories. md An example project on the article I wrote about setting up react's context api with typescript - damiisdandy/context-api-typescript Talkr is the lightest i18n provider for React applications. You should use React Context when you need a state in multiple pages or parts of GitHub is where people build software. React Tutorial Application in that: Each Tutorial has id, title, description, published status. The library offers you: simple syntax with HOC components like react-redux. - edinhadzovic/typescript-react-app-context The tsconfig. A web app built with TypeScript, and React Hooks(useContext, useReducer). React Native TypeScript More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. Write better code with AI Security. Code can be found in these branches. env are configuration files. typescript development by creating an account on GitHub. Skip to content. react minify react-context-hooks This repo contains an example usage of React Context API implemented with TypeScript. FC) is not needed. Context API and React Router. React Typescript Login and I often see questions in the Keycloak forums on how to use it with React. You switched accounts on another tab This project was bootstrapped with Create React App. js applications. App Development: Step by Step Guide To start a new typescript app, React Singleton Context is a small library to alleviate the pain points that come with using React Context in micro-frontend architectures. However, being forced to make so many choices can be overwhelming. connect; This tutorial assumes you have some basic knowledge of using TypeScript with React. Plan and track work Code More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. The application has a global state that are the notes which are accessed by all the This is an open source library that shares a set of utilities that can be used to support Micro-Frontend architecture in your React. Plan and track work Code Mocking react 16 context in jest (typescript version) - mocking. All 9 JavaScript 5 TypeScript 4. API Sauce, MobX + MobX React Lite, React Context, React Navigation Authentication flows + useFocusEffect, React Native Web GitHub is where people build software. Contribute to robinhuy/react-native-typescript-examples development by creating an account on GitHub. The Routes were setup for four default A tiny wrapper library around the React Context API that reduces the amount of boilerplate code required to create and consume contexts. In real-life import * as React from 'react'; import { BrowserRouter as Router, Link, Redirect, Route, RouteComponentProps, withRouter } from 'react-router-dom'; import React, { useContext } from 'react'; // First, we need to create a context export const MyContext = React. Builds the app for production to the build folder. It contains all source files of the code examples found in the guide. You signed out in another tab or window. test, Most existing libraries rely DSLs and string interpolation, or gettext, and they are usually slow compared to simpler javascript template literals. It's packed with examples and guidance on A complete example of how to architect a React app using the Context API - upmostly/react-context-example GitHub is where people build software. It correctly bundles React in production mode and optimizes the build for the best The examples in this repository leverage pnpm and workspaces. Topics Trending How to use React 16 context api. The code is generated by the create-react-app TypeScript addition. It is designed to be defined as a singleton, and it This is a Sample React Project with the integration of Pieces npm package. Contribute to godon019/typescript-react-useContext-example development by creating an account on GitHub. An example of deep linking execution in React Native using TypeScript and react-navigation. // Place your snippets for typescript here. On the other hand, I often see questions in the react-oidc-context repo on how to use it with Keycloak. If you are not familiar with useReducer and useContext, have read through in ReactJS site. In this article, we will see how to use useReducer and useContext hooks together with typescript in a step-by-step guide. AI-powered developer platform Example project for the react and node with typescript - bbachi/react-nodejs-typescript-example npx create-react-app use-context-react --template typescript npm install react-router-dom npm install bootstrap react-bootstrap. 🛍️ Simple ecommerce cart application built with Typescript and React. Contribute to unlight/react-typescript-realworld-example-app development by creating an account on GitHub. The configurations found in . 1, it is even React - Context Snippets. To review, open the file in an Simple Task Manager using context-api and react hooks with edit features and LocalStorage. We welcome your contributions to Pieces! All changes need a pull request & thumbs-up from our maintainers React Context and useContext is often used to avoid prop drilling, however it's known that there's a performance issue. I walkthrough Chapter 15 of '리액트를 다루는 기술' book, and adopt TypeScript on it The whole point of useFormContext is to access the original form methods, but typing goes out the window if you don't provide the same type as you did in the original More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. According to documentation. - changwng/react-contextapi-with-typescript Set of basic React + Typescript guided samples, cover basic principles of this technology. JS and Keycloak IAM & SSO integration. PHP as Backend. Contribute to davidkariuki/typescript-react-context-example development by creating an account on GitHub. This is a simple to-do-list web application built with React JS , React component to provide OpenID Connect and OAuth2 protocol support. context. Instant dev environments Issues. It is This project is intended to get you off and running with React, React Router and Typescript! You signed in with another tab or window. ReactNode[];}; type Context = {isExpanded: boolean; toggleItem?: const Context = React. 🛒 A simple shopping cart with More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. They are all tested with the most recent version of TypeScript and 3rd party type-definitions (like This configuration will remove the Inspector menu item from the context menu displayed when the user right-clicks inside the client area of the app window. To run from a git checkout locally, remove all of the proprietary example directories, ensure you have pnpm installed and The goal is to open source knowledge:. (React, I want to use a context within my React Typescript project, how can I do that? I have the following code: App. development, . The updates include an exploration of when to use React Context, an React is still trendy nowadays in general, and using React Context APIs has become a common pattern to share global data between components as well. Context components. - eugenehp/react-native-deep-linking TypeScript sample implementations of common React. This is a simple example of how to use the react-oidc-context library with NextJS. You learned how to create and use the React Context API in NextJS app with Typescript. React Typescript Login and Registration example - JWT Authentication & Ultimate example of react context hook with nice type-safe (TypeScript) wrappers and reduced boilerplate by using `ReturnType` - README. Write what you wish you had known; What you will want to refer to in future; Identify what you don't know and actively ask for community to fill in the gaps GitHub Copilot. js on TodoMVC top page, you might seen A simple example of how to build a context component for your react application. It supports Typescript, provides autocompletion, has 0 dependencies, and is very easy to use. so, you've come to the right place. The application has a global state that are the notes which are accessed by all the Instantly share code, notes, and snippets. GitHub Gist: instantly share code, notes, and snippets. createContext<MyContextType | undefined>(undefined); // More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. useContext, by using the MobXProviderContext context that can be imported from mobx-react. Topics Trending Collections Enterprise Enterprise platform. You may go through TypeScript with React Tutorial to get started. ; react-scripts is a development dependency in the Template React Project using create-react-app & TypeScript - tduyng/react-typescript-example It would be great if the first code example here was converted to Typescript to show as a guide to users Just to complete the answer about using contexts with typescript The goal of this project is to provide a set of simple samples, providing and step by step guide to start working with React and Typescript. ReactNode | React. Can be used either via the context API or by using the hook ⚛️ A simple vite react typescript starter template with husky, conventional commit, eslint, stylelint, prettier, sass, tailwindcss, material ui, tanstack routing, redux and saga, vitest This comprehensive template is perfect for beginners looking to dive straight into building a Chrome Extension using React and TypeScript. It is useful for sharing data between the app. Prerequisites: Basic familiarity with React and Typescript. What is useReducer?. Each snippet is defined under a snippet name and has a prefix, body and. Talkr is the lightest i18n provider for React applications. Complex text and mix of HTML, dynamic React-providers is a library which helps you to work and manage React. When you found React. A redux-less This project is for a notes app, which I did to practice using the Context API that ReactJS has and also how to use it alongside Typescript. A practical example: Define import { createContext, useContext, useState } from 'react'; type Props = {children: React. The project was made using create-react-app and Build a React Typescript and Axios CRUD example to consume Web API with Router & Bootstrap 4. Example App. tsx This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. createContext<Context | undefined>(undefined); Context. GitHub - badih76/use-context-react: More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. tsx This project was started with the goal of continue to publish TodoMVC Apps in the latest React writing style. This project welcomes contributions and suggestions. sidx8 / Chatbot-flow Check out our Playground Project located in the /playground folder. Sample application to demonstrate Context api using TypeScript. env. Most contributions require you to React is an excellent tool for building front-end applications. With this approach, there's no need for 3rd party dependencies (besides the official default keycloak-js Build React Typescript Authentication and Authorization example using React Hooks, React Router, Axios and Bootstrap (without Redux): JWT Authentication Flow for User Signup & This project is for a notes app, which I did to practice using the Context API that ReactJS has and also how to use it alongside Typescript. Use only part of Editor’s note: This article was last reviewed and updated by Popoola Temitope on 4 December 2024. If you're still using React 17 or TypeScript lower than 5. Check out the UltiSnips folder to see available snippets. Getting Started Run the following command to install the dependencies and start the application: Hooks: set of samples migrated to hooks (right now 15 samples migrated), if you are new to React, or you are going to start working on a new project, We recommend you going through ⚛️ Sample Quiz App using React Hooks (useReducer() + useContext()). // description. Automate any workflow Codespaces. React Context and Typescript. addPage adds a new page object to the Create React App is divided into two packages: create-react-app is a global command-line utility that you use to create new projects. It has a diverse ecosystem with hundreds of great libraries for literally anything you might need. Unlike many similar libraries, react-right-click-menu simply provides a context environment, where consumer provides an actual It is possible to read the stores provided by Provider using React. Starter kit for react with redux and react material ui in typescript. An Apple Music UI inspired NOTE: I no longer use UltiSnips so the snippets might be different. qoehceawitcrsmiszuyrmxwpbgeryzkouphahiqdxxxttyxjukxd